Treatment Options for Alopecia Areata 

Many treatments exist for alopecia areata, ranging from oral medications to topical solutions to office-based approaches like microneedling. While all have documented some success in treating alopecia areata, we’ve found that one treatment stands out in this area: platelet-rich plasma (PRP).

PRP uses your blood, specifically its platelets, to treat hair loss. Platelets are packed with growth factors that stimulate cellular repair and regeneration. These growth factors can activate the stem cells in dormant hair follicles, prompting them to enter the growth phase.

PRP also works in other ways to promote hair regrowth. It boosts local circulation to your scalp, delivering more oxygen and nutrients to hair follicles to help your hair grow. It also reduces inflammation, which is often a major factor in alopecia areata.

Overall, PRP harnesses the body’s natural healing processes to revitalize hair follicles and promote sustainable hair regrowth. Studies show that PRP is an effective, safe, and minimally invasive strategy for hair regrowth in those with alopecia areata.

The PRP Treatment Process

PRP therapy involves a non-surgical procedure with no downtime. Here’s how it works:

  • Blood Draw: First, we draw a small amount of your blood. It’s similar to any other blood draw, taking just a few minutes.
  • Platelet Concentration: We use a centrifuge to spin down your blood to extract and concentrate platelets.
  • Injections: Dr. Banta injects the platelets into your scalp using a thin needle. The whole process generally takes under an hour.
  • Treatment Schedule: Typically, three treatments are spaced one month apart.

Patients often start to see results in only a couple of months. Initially, the new hair is fine and thinner but it steadily increases in thickness and density.

Who Is a Good Candidate for PRP for Alopecia Areata?

Ideal candidates for PRP treatment in San Antonio have dormant (not dead) hair follicles and generally healthy scalps. Dr. Banta expertly assesses your eligibility during an in-depth consultation. 

It’s important to note that PRP is not recommended for anyone with chronic health conditions like heart disease, diabetes, or kidney failure. Dr. Banta can create a treatment plan to manage your alopecia areata based on your unique health needs.
